Makofi Guest House - Nungwi
-5.73115, 39.29272Situated approximately a 5-minute walk from Baobop, Makofi Guest House Nungwi includes 44 rooms with views of the garden. The guest house serves African dishes prepared in the à la carte restaurant on site.
Location
The Panje Project is a short distance from this hotel, while Baraka Natural Aquarium- Nungwi is merely 0.9 miles away. From the property it will take 18 minutes to walk to Mnarani Marine Turtles Conservation Pond Aquarium. The hotel is located 650 feet from MyBlue beach, in Nungwi.
Daladalas to Stone Town bus station is also a few minutes' drive from Makofi Guest House.
Rooms
Certain rooms have soundproof windows along with a writing desk for guests' convenience. Some rooms are fitted with a private bathroom.
Eat & Drink
Rooftops bar offers a selection of dishes about 5 minutes by foot from this Nungwi accommodation.
